The MAX1705/MAX1706 are designed to supply both
power and low-noise circuitry in portable RF and data-
acquisition instruments. They combine a linear regula-
tor, step-up switching regulator, n-channel power
MOSFET, p-channel synchronous rectifier, precision
reference, and low-battery comparator in a single 16-
pin QSOP package (Figure 1). The switching DC-DC
converter boosts a 1- or 2-cell input to an adjustable
output between 2.5V and 5.5V. The internal low-dropout
regulator provides linear postregulation for noise-
sensitive circuitry, as well as outputs from 1.25V to
300mV below the switching-regulator output. The
MAX1705/MAX1706 start from a low, 1.1V input and
remain operational down to 0.7V.
These devices are optimized for use in cellular phones
and other applications requiring low noise during full-
power operation, as well as low quiescent current for

maximum battery life during standby and shutdown.
They feature constant-frequency (300kHz), low-noise
pulse-width-modulation (PWM) operation with 300mA or
730mA output capability from 1 or 2 cells, respectively,
with 3.3V output. A low-quiescent-current standby
pulse-frequency-modulation (PFM) mode offers an out-
put up to 60mA and 140µA, respectively, and reduces
quiescent power consumption to 500µW. In shutdown
mode, the quiescent current is further reduced to just
1µA. Figure 2 shows the standard application circuit for
the MAX1705 configured in high-power PWM mode.
Additional features include synchronous rectification for
high efficiency and improved battery life, and an
uncommitted comparator for low-battery detection. A
CLK/SEL input allows frequency synchronization to
reduce interference. Dual shutdown controls allow shut-
down using a momentary pushbutton switch and micro-
processor control.
